A Poet He Is, But The Messiah? Not Donovan

Loraine Alterman, GO, 8 November 1968

GLASGOW'S GENTLEST son, Donovan, breezed into the Plaza Nine Room at New York's famous Plaza Hotel for a press conference. Wearing lavender trousers, a blue shirt and a red vinyl jacket, Donovan answered questions from a variety of underground bearded types who seemed to think he was the Messiah.
